About Distill Distill is building AI-powered research for the modern go-to-market team. We use large language models (LLMs) to transform information from across the web into rich, actionable profiles on people and companies—helping sales, recruiting, investing, and business development teams make better decisions, faster. Think of Distill as AI-powered research built for GTM teams. Founded in 2024 by serial entrepreneurs Russ Heddleston (DocSend → Dropbox, Pursuit → Meta) and Tim Su (Astrid → Yahoo, Tandem), Distill is backed by top-tier venture investors (funding announcement coming soon). We're a remote-first team building AI products people genuinely love to use. The Opportunity We're looking for our first Implementation Specialist to own the customer onboarding experience from kickoff through launch. You'll work directly with customers to understand their business, configure Distill to fit their workflows, build their first projects, and ensure they see value quickly. Along the way, you'll partner closely with our founders, Product, and Engineering to improve both our onboarding experience and the product itself. As one of the first hires in this function, you'll help define how customer implementations are done as we scale. What You'll Do Own customer implementations from kickoff to successful launch Learn each customer's business and configure Distill around their goals Build customer workflows, target audiences, and search configurations Guide customers through onboarding, training, and adoption Identify blockers and proactively drive implementations forward Create playbooks, templates, and best practices that improve every future implementation Partner closely with Product and Engineering to turn customer feedback into product improvements Help transform manual implementation work into scalable product capabilities What We're Looking For 3+ years in Implementation, Solutions Consulting, Customer Success, Technical Account Management, or a similar customer-facing role Experience onboarding SaaS customers from kickoff through go-live Strong project management and organizational skills Comfortable working directly with customers and cross-functional teams Curious, analytical, and excited to solve ambiguous problems Comfortable learning AI products and adopting new technologies quickly Excellent written and verbal communication skills Thrives in early-stage startup environments where you'll build processes—not just follow them Why Join Distill? Work directly with experienced founders who have built and exited multiple successful startups Help shape both the customer experience and the product from the ground up Join at an early stage with significant ownership and influence Build with cutting-edge AI technology that's solving real customer problems Remote-first culture with a high degree of autonomy and trust Competitive salary and equity
